furtest 8733167ae3 synchroniser : do not use mutable as default argument
Default arguments are evaluated only once meaning if they are mutables
they are shared between every function invocation.
See the warning here:
https://docs.python.org/3/tutorial/controlflow.html#default-argument-values

So use None instead of [] and replace it by the list in the body of the
function.
